Urgent: Magento/Adobe Commerce Security Update APSB25-26
Critical Vulnerabilities Patched On April 08, 2025, Adobe released a critical security patch (APSB25-26) for Adobe Commerce and Magento Open Source. This update addresses important and moderate flaws that could lead to security feature bypass, privilege escalation, and application denial-of-service. What's Included in APSB25-26? This patch contains fixes for 4 Important, and 1 Moderate issues. Affected Versions: Magento Open Source: 2.4.8-beta2 2.4.7-p4 and earlier 2.4.6-p9 and earlier 2.4.5-p11

Fixing Checkout Page Issues in CSP Restricted Mode for Adobe Commerce / Magento 2.4.7
Content Security Policy (CSP) is a powerful security feature that helps mitigate XSS attacks by restricting the sources from which scripts can be loaded on a web page. However, it can sometimes interfere with the functionality of the storefront checkout page in Adobe Commerce (formerly Magento 2).
